The Oppo Enco Clip 2 are described as suitable earbuds designed for very specific use cases. They excel during casual listening, particularly when the wearer needs to maintain situational awareness while exploring or working. The design is notable for its open nature, which contributes to this key feature. However, this openness means that performance declines in loud environments. The product is presented as a valuable companion pair rather than a primary, all-purpose set of headphones.
The Enco Clip 2 offers several advantages, including an all-day comfortable fit and strong situational awareness capabilities. Users benefit from its lightweight, cuff-style open design, which rests outside the ear canal. This structure allows for all-day wear without noticeable pressure.
In terms of smart features and connectivity, the earbuds include support for Spotify Tap, custom EQ settings, earbud fall detection, and camera controls, all managed through the HeyMelody app. The device also provides solid call quality, utilizing microphones and bone conduction technology to ensure reliable calling performance.
Furthermore, the Enco Clip 2 features IP55 rating, Bluetooth 6.1 and LHDC support, and a battery life that can last long enough for a typical workday. Sound quality is noted as being great when paired with staying aware of one’s environment, though it is also described as lacking in bass.
Customers should consider purchasing these earbuds if their primary priorities are all-day comfort and situational awareness. The cuff-style design is highlighted for keeping things genuinely open, allowing music, podcasts, or calls to be heard without blocking out the surrounding world.
The drawbacks of the device center on its lack of isolation features. Since it has no passive or active noise cancellation (ANC), the open design allows external sounds to pass through easily. Consequently, users report that in loud environments—such as buses, trains, and planes—the earbuds struggle significantly.
In summary, the Oppo Enco Clip 2 is recommended for casual listening during exploration, commuting, or at work. Its benefit lies in combining all-day comfort with a genuinely open design that avoids clamping the head or blocking the ears like traditional earbuds.
